Position Summary:
As the Field Technician III, you will join our team of technicians based in Savannah, Georgia supporting business and civil large aviation customers in our repair station shop. In this role you will provide maintenance, repair, and overhaul services on aircraft engines and you will work varying shifts and travel domestically and internationally up to 80%. This role will have occasional on-call weekends once a month.
Whatyou will be doing:
- Comply with work scope instructions as directed by our Maintenance Operations Control
- Perform on-wing and off-wing engine maintenance including engine changes.
- Must be able to obtain and maintain repair station inspection approvals.
- Ability to interface with customers.
- Ability to lift up to approximately 50 pounds and pass a required eye exam
- Use troubleshooting logic to identify defects in component or parts and access / use engine data materials such as AMM, EMM, IPC, etc.
- Understand; interpret and apply Service Bulletins, FAA Advisory Directives and Technical Variances when applicable
- High School Diploma or GED (General Educational Development) with 3+ years of aircraft maintenance, repair, and/or overhaul experience with FAA Airframe & Power Plant License, OR
- Associate degree with 2+ years of aircraft maintenance, repair, and/or overhaul with FAA Airframe & Power Plant License
- This position is a FAA designated safety-sensitive position. Selected candidate must successfully complete a FAA/DOT pre-employment background check, a FAA/DOT drug screen that tests for the presence of Marijuana, Cocaine, Opiates, Phencyclidine and Amphetamines (or metabolites of those drugs) and comply with FAA-mandated rules on drug and alcohol use.
